Pupils' desks are part of the historic furnishings at the Schoolhouse, one of the historic buildings in the park.
Herbert Hoover National Historic Site's landscape, buildings, and exhibits, symbolize American ideals of religion, education, hard work, community, and entrepreneurship as Herbert Hoover saw them and lived them. Did You Know?
Herbert Hoover was the first person born west of the Mississippi River to become president. Seven other presidents were born west of the river.
